Black Friday = Pricewatch Bekijk onze selectie van de beste Black Friday-deals en voorkom een miskoop.
Toon posts:

Kan mysql extensie niet laden

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ik heb een probleem met mijn php/phpmyadmin/mysql/apache installatie, alles lukt perfect tot phpmyadmin wanneer ik dit heb geconfigureerd en open dan krijg ik steenvast de error "kan de mysql extensie niet laden"..

Ik heb de tutorial op http://www.phphulp.nl/php/tutorials/8/462/1047/ gevolg (wat ik overigens vroeger al meermaals zonder problemen heb kunnen doen hiermee..)

- Heb in php.ini de ; weggehaald bij php_mysql php_mysqli en libmysql
- Heb d:\server\web toegevoegd aan m'n environment variables
- Heb tot overmaat van ramp alle dll's al eens naar c:\windows\system32 en \system gezet om te testen of dat zou werken.
- Heb de dll's ook al gekopieerd naar d:\server\apache\bin
- Als ik phpinfo() oproep zie ik daar verwijzingen naar mysql
- Veel gegoogled, en ze zeggen steeds hetzelfde zie dat de ; weg zijn in php.ini WEL ZE ZIJN WEG :)

De versie van php is 5.2.6 en phpmyadmin 3.0
mysql werkt echter wel goed want ik kan connecteren via mysql administrator maar dat werkt niet goed vandaar dat ik phpmyadmin wil..

Verder draait de installatie op een server2003 ent machine op poort 81 (omdat symantec reporting service al op poort 80 draait.)

Ik ben ten einde raad, maar vind alles opnieuw installeren ook geen goede keuze, misschien dat iemand van jullie wel wat kan helpen..

  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

En deze stap:
Ga naar de map C:\server\web\phpMyAdmin\config en knip het bestand config.inc.php en plak het in C:\server\web\phpMyAdmin

Wat staat er in je phpmyadmin config ?
Kan je die eens posten?

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


Verwijderd

Topicstarter
in de config.inc.php staat:

PHP: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
<?php
/*
 * Generated configuration file
 * Generated by: phpMyAdmin 3.0.0 setup script by Michal &#268;iha&#345; <michal@cihar.com>
 * Version: $Id: setup.php 11423 2008-07-24 17:26:05Z lem9 $
 * Date: Sat, 18 Oct 2008 10:06:18 GMT
 */

/* Servers configuration */
$i = 0;

/* Server localhost (http) [1] */
$i++;
$cfg['Servers'][$i]['host'] = 'localhost';
$cfg['Servers'][$i]['extension'] = 'mysql';
$cfg['Servers'][$i]['connect_type'] = 'tcp';
$cfg['Servers'][$i]['compress'] = false;
$cfg['Servers'][$i]['auth_type'] = 'http';

/* End of servers configuration */

?>

  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

Draait je mysql poort wel op de default waarde (dus niet je webserver....)

En gebruik je nou MySQL of MySQLi?
Heb je al geprobeert om een phpscriptje te schrijven wat een basic connectie maakt naar de DB?
Zo kan je je probleem isoleren...

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


Verwijderd

Topicstarter
- mysql draait op normale poort
- Mysql werkt wel degelik, ik heb gisteren vanuit vb.net een connectie kunnen maken naar de databank, ook kan ik zoals eerder gezegd wel een verbinding maken met bv mysql administrator op de default port 3306 ...

  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

op de default port 3306 .
Dat staat nergens en wij proberen je alleen maar te helpen. Ik ga je dus nogmaals dezelfde vraag stellen...
Kan je vanuit PHP (dus niet VB.NET) een connectie maken naar de database?
Heb je al geprobeert om een phpscriptje te schrijven wat een basic connectie maakt naar de DB?
Zo kan je je probleem isoleren...

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


Verwijderd

Topicstarter
Owkey net ff gedaan en dan gat het inderdaad ook niet :/

PHP Fatal error: Call to undefined function mysql_connect() in D:\server\web\test.php on line 2.

  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

dan weet je dus nu waar je het moet zoeken....staat de extensie dir in je php.ini goed ?

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


  • Creepy
  • Registratie: Juni 2001
  • Laatst online: 02:24

Creepy

Tactical Espionage Splatterer

Fastex schreef op zaterdag 18 oktober 2008 @ 12:49:
dan weet je dus nu waar je het moet zoeken....staat de extensie dir in je php.ini goed ?
Had dat gelijk genoemd. In de startpost staat al dat de mysql extensie niet geladen kan worden. Dus PHP kan de MySQL module niet laden. Scheelt weer gezeur over MySQl installaties en poorten ;)

"I had a problem, I solved it with regular expressions. Now I have two problems". That's shows a lack of appreciation for regular expressions: "I know have _star_ problems" --Kevlin Henney


  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

haha, zat er later ook aan te denken ja....Ik wist alleen niet of het een phpmyadmin error of een php error was...

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


Verwijderd

Topicstarter
Toen ik daarnet op m'n server zocht naar php.ini kwam ik tot mijn stomste verbazing ook nog een php.ini tegen die verwees naar de Symantec Reporting server, en jawel die reporting server heeft ook php geinstalleerd en wel op IIS...
En dit zal meer dan waarschijnllijk ook het probleem zijn.. Omdat ik die reporting server toch niet gebruik ga ik deze eraf gooien en nogmaals proberen via Apache..

  • Mike2k
  • Registratie: Mei 2002
  • Laatst online: 23-10 07:43

Mike2k

Zone grote vuurbal jonge! BAM!

Als je die reporting server eraf gooit, zet dan je webserver poort terug naar poortje 80....

You definitely rate about a 9.0 on my weird-shit-o-meter
Chuck Norris doesn't dial the wrong number. You answer the wrong phone.


Verwijderd

Topicstarter
Ik heb hem eraf gegooid, maar dan ging het nog niet, toch maar eens opnieuw begonnen met de installatie en dan gaat het wel perfect..
Blijkbaar heeft die reporting server toch wel het een en het ander in de knoop laten draaien ..
Pagina: 1